Organizers, meanwhile, are calling the scheme a peaceful “leaderless resistance movement.” But the precise roots and origin of the efforts still remain somewhat of a mystery.

Several sources said the first call to arms came in mid-July in the magazine AdBusters, which describes itself as “anti-consumerist.” The idea quickly picked up steam. And numerous organizations have since popped up to support the effort.

“Alright you redeemers, rebels, radicals and utopian dreamers out there, we are living through a rare crisis and moment of opportunity,” noted a message (http://www.adbusters.org/blogs/adbusters-blog/occupywallstreet.html), signed “Culture Jammers HQ,” posted on the magazine’s website. “A worldwide shift in revolutionary tactics is underway right now that bodes well for the future.”

According to the statement, demonstrators would be zeroing in on one specific demand to “propel us toward the radical democracy of the future.” The “flood” of activists in New York, the message said, would then “incessantly repeat our one simple demand until Barack Obama capitulates.”
